The marker text reads: Edwin S. Porter Motion picture pioneer, born in Connellsville. Developed concepts of film editing, screenplay,
and other cinematic techniques. In early 20th century, he was America's leading director; his most famous film was "The Great Train Robbery," 1903.

Porter worked alongside George S. Fleming at Thomas Alva Edison's Edison Manufacturing Company. Porter and Fleming were typical of the collaborative production teams working in the US before 1908-09.
